show gtpp counters
Displays GTPP counters for configured Charging Gateway Functions (CGFs) within the given context.
Product
ePDG
GGSN
P-GW
SAEGW
SGSN
Privilege
Security Administrator, Administrator, Operator, Inspector
Command Modes
Exec

Syntax Description
show gtpp counters { all [ gcdrs ] | cgf-address ipv4/ipv6_address [ gcdrs ] | group name group_name } [
| { grep grep_options | more } ]
all
Displays counters for all CGFs configured within the context.
cgf-address ipv4/ipv6_address [ gcdrs ]
Displays counters for a CGF specified by its IP address in IPv4 dotted-decimal or IPv6
colon-separated-hexadecimal notation.

gcdrs: Displays G-CDR specific GTPP counters only.
group name group_name
Displays counters for a GTPP server group name specified as an alphanumeric string of 1 through 63 characters.
| { grep grep_options | more }
Pipes (sends) the output of this command to a specified command. You must specify a command to which
the output of this command will be sent.
